Coverage Options for Table Grove Properties
Dwelling Fire Forms
- DP-1 (Basic): Named perils; ACV on many losses. Suitable for lower-value properties.
- DP-2 (Broad): Adds perils like windstorms; a balanced option for rural settings.
- DP-3 (Special): Open perils on the dwelling; ideal for well-maintained homes.
Essential Add-Ons
- Liability Coverage: Standard for property protection.
- Windstorm/Hail: Important in Illinois for storm-related risks.
- Ordinance or Law: Covers code upgrades for older structures.
- Flood: Consider NFIP for potential flooding.

DP-1 vs DP-2 vs DP-3 (Quick Compare)
| Feature | DP-1 | DP-2 | DP-3 |
|---|---|---|---|
| Peril scope | Basic named perils | Broad named perils | Special (open perils) on dwelling |
| Settlement | Often ACV | ACV or RC | Typically RC |
| Best fit | Lower cost needs | Balanced protection | Well-maintained properties |
